FIRST AMENDMENT TO AGREEMENT FOR IRREVOCABLE STANDBY LETTERS OF CREDIT
This First Amendment to Agreement for Irrevocable Standby Letters of Credit, dated as of November 3, 2025 (this “Amendment”), is entered into by and between Peabody Energy Corporation, a Delaware corporation (the “Applicant”), and Goldman Sachs Bank USA (the “Issuer”).
    RECITALS    
WHEREAS, the Applicant and the Issuer have entered into that certain Agreement for Irrevocable Standby Letters of Credit, dated as of February 17, 2022 (as may be amended, supplemented or otherwise modified from time to time, the “LC Agreement”);
WHEREAS, the Applicant has requested that the Issuer agree to extend the expiration date of the LC Agreement; and
WHEREAS, the Applicant and the Issuer desire to amend certain provisions of the LC Agreement in the manner and on the terms and conditions provided for herein.
NOW THEREFORE, in consideration of the premises and the mutual covenants and the agreements herein set forth and other good and valuable consideration, the receipt and sufficiency of which are hereby acknowledged, the parties hereto, intending to be legally bound, agree as follows:                                                
ARTICLE I
Definitions
Section 1.1.Certain Definitions. Capitalized terms used herein but not otherwise defined herein shall have the meanings ascribed thereto in the LC Agreement.
ARTICLE II
Amendments
Section 2.1.Amendments to LC Agreement.
(a)The first sentence of Section 7(b) is hereby amended and restated in its entirety as follows:
As long as any Credit is outstanding or any drawing thereunder shall not have been fully reimbursed to Issuer, the aggregate sum in United States dollars on deposit in the Collateral Accounts shall not be less than 102% of the Credit Exposure (defined below) at such time (the “Minimum Collateral Amount”); provided that in the event that the credit rating of Applicant falls below B- by S&P or B3 by Moody’s, the Minimum Collateral Amount shall automatically be increased to 103% on the second (2nd) Business Day following such ratings decline (the “Minimum Collateral Amount”).

(b)Section 14 is hereby amended and restated in its entirety as follows:
Continuing Agreement; Termination.
This Agreement is a continuing agreement and may not be terminated by Applicant except upon (i) ten (10) days’ prior written notice of such termination by Applicant to Issuer at the address of Issuer set forth on the most recent Credit issued hereunder, (ii) payment of all Obligations in full, and (iii) the expiration or cancellation of all Credits issued hereunder with no pending drawing remaining under any Credit previously issued hereunder. This Agreement shall terminate without any action from the parties hereto on the later of (a) December 31, 2030 (the “Initial Expiration Date”) and (b) the date on which the events described in clauses (ii) and (iii) of the immediately preceding sentence have occurred.”
ARTICLE III
Effectiveness of Amendments
Section 3.1.Amendment Effective Date. The amendments set forth in Article II hereof shall be effective on and as of the date (the “Amendment Effective Date”) of the satisfaction, or waiver by the Issuer of the following conditions:
(a)The Issuer shall have received this Amendment duly executed by the Applicant.
(b)The Issuer shall have received (i) such customary certificates of resolutions or other action, incumbency certificates and/or other certificates of officers of the Applicant as the Issuer may require evidencing the identity, authority and capacity of each officer thereof authorized to act as an officer in connection with this Amendment, (ii) a solvency certificate, (iii) a customary legal opinion of Jones Day, addressed to the Issuer and dated as of the Amendment Effective Date and (iv) such other documents and certificates (including organizational documents and good standing certificates) as the Issuer may reasonably request relating to the organization, existence and good standing of the Applicant and any other legal matters relating to the Applicant, this Amendment or the transactions contemplated hereby.
(c)The Issuer shall have received all reasonable and documented out-of-pocket fees and expenses incurred by the Issuer (including the reasonable and documented fees, charges and disbursements of counsel for the Issuer) in connection with the preparation, negotiation and execution of this Amendment.
